Mattress toppers and pressure points

By adding an extra layer of comfort between you and your mattress, you can experience relief from those pesky pressure points. But sometimes, no matter how much you toss and turn, the mattress topper you are lying on fails to offer you the right support and cushioning, leading to pressure points. This is probably because you chose the wrong mattress topper.

Pressure point varies from person to person and is highly linked to the sleeping position. For example, side sleepers have different pressure points when compared to those who prefer sleeping on their back or stomach.

Have a look at the common pressure points related to sleeping positions:

  • Shoulder - Common among side sleepers
  • Hips - Common among side sleepers
  • Tailbone - Common among back sleepers
  • Ribs - Common among stomach sleepers
  • Knees - Common among stomach sleepers who sleep with one leg crossed over the other and side sleepers
  • Heels - Common among back sleepers.

How can a mattress topper relieve pressure points?

A mattress topper can offer pressure point relief in so many ways.

First, they help in evenly dispersing bodyweight so that all your weight isn't hitting on the major pressure points.

Second, a mattress topper offers a comfort layer between you and your mattress and molds itself around the curves of your body, reducing the force around the pressure points.

Finally, mattress toppers can keep your spine well-aligned and offer better support to relieve all kinds of aches and pains you may experience in the morning.

For all these reasons and many more, mattress toppers can be a smart investment in the quality and comfort of your sleep.

Types of mattress toppers for pressure relief

A good quality topper can make all the difference in the world when it comes to getting a good night's sleep. Here are some of the most common types of mattress toppers with pressure-relieving properties.

1. Latex mattress toppers

latex mattress topper

With a latex mattress topper, you can get the best night's sleep of your life. You won't have to worry about waking up in pain or discomfort ever again, thanks to its incredible pressure-relieving properties!

Natural latex provides the ideal blend of support and comfort to relieve pressure on your hips, shoulders, back, and other major problem areas that cause discomfort when you wake up in the morning.

Natural latex has a buoyant quality that provides both surface cushion and firmness. It also cradles the sleeper's body without much sinkage while supporting the lower back. The result is a combination of pressure point relief and proper body and spinal alignment.

Latex mattress toppers also tend to be highly durable and offer outstanding temperature regulation. Plus, it's made from natural materials, so you can rest easy knowing you aren't harming the environment.

However, they are pretty much more expensive than other types of toppers. But you can buy with confidence that you're getting a quality mattress topper.

2. Memory foam mattress toppers

memory foam mattress topper

A memory foam topper typically conforms closely to your body. Not only does this topper provide outstanding cradling for shoulders, back, and hips, but it also allows your muscles to fully relax and release tension. Memory foam mattress toppers also isolate motion well, which means you won't even notice when your partner changes position in between sleep.

One potential drawback of memory foam is that it tends to trap heat, making you sleep hot. However, some memory foam toppers are made with special features like cooling gel beads for added breathability. However, they aren't a healthy and sustainable option.

Memory foam mattress toppers are also usually slow to respond to changes in pressure, making it pretty tough for sleepers to move around and change position.

3. Gel-infused memory foam mattress toppers

Gel memory foam - high density mattress topper

A gel memory foam topper can help with pressure relief! While still made of memory foam, these toppers offer the same level of structured comfort and support you expect from traditional memory foam but with the added bonus of gel infusion, which helps regulate temperature.

However, just like memory foam, they are slow to respond to changes in pressure. And unlike latex, they aren't a very healthy and sustainable option.

4. Wool mattress toppers

wool mattress topper

Another option when it comes to providing pressure relief is the wool mattress topper. However, when you use a wool mattress topper, you won't get the same level of support and pain relief as that of latex or memory foam.

As a material, wool offers cool comfort and outstanding temperature regulation properties. Because of their light and natural composition, wool toppers are very durable, supportive, and good at softening a firm mattress.

Also, wool mattress toppers are particularly pricier and somewhat hard to find on the market. And, when you buy one, there's an initial smell that spreads out.

5. Down mattress toppers

down alternative mattress topper

If you're looking for a luxury feel that cradles your pressure points, then down mattress toppers are great. However, it has a tendency to bunch up and clump together, causing discomfort at times. Also, they aren't supportive enough as foam toppers.

6. Polyfoam mattress toppers

Polyfoam mattress toppers

Running out of money but want a mattress topper to relieve pressure points? Polyfoam is another option! They are somewhat supportive, cushioning the hips, shoulders, and other pressure points. However, they aren't as great as natural latex or memory foam.

Factors to consider before buying the best mattress toppers for pressure point relief

There are several considerations you should take into account before buying a pressure-relief mattress topper. This includes:

  • Material

The type of material that makes up your mattress topper matters! In fact, it is what determines the performance and durability of your mattress topper.

Be it comfort, support, or heat retention, a high-quality mattress topper has it all! In contrast, cheap-quality toppers lack all these features and aren't durable.

  • Firmness

Firmness is another important factor to consider when shopping for a mattress topper, as it will determine how well your body sinks into its surface.

mattress topper firmness scale

For those who sleep on their back or stomach, a medium-firm topper works best. Side sleeper? Pick either the medium-soft or medium option for comfort's sake!

Bodyweight also has a huge impact on what firmness feels right. If you weigh over 230 pounds, you may sink too deeply into a soft mattress topper, and you may need a firm or extra firm option.

If you weigh below 130 pounds, you may not put enough pressure on a firm mattress topper to sink in and feel totally cradled, so you'd likely want to go for a softer topper.

And if you weigh between 230 and 130 pounds, you should go for a medium firm mattress topper.

  • Thickness

The thickness of a mattress topper also impacts how significantly it provides pressure relief.

mattress topper thickness scale

A thin topper, 1 to 2 inches thick, may add a bit of cushioning. On the other hand, a thicker one, that is, a 3 inch or a 4 inch mattress topper, is more likely to offer great contouring and pressure relief.

The right mattress topper can offer pressure point relief and support your spine's natural alignment. But did you know that each sleep position affects the spine differently? So, those struggling with pressure points may also want to consider the role of their preferred sleeping position.

best pressure relief mattress topper - latex toppers with high quality materials
  • Best pressure relief mattress topper for side sleepers

Are you a side sleeper? If yes, go for a thicker and plusher latex mattress topper. Since you have more pressure points than a stomach or back sleeper, you need a soft mattress topper. And you may also need a thicker mattress topper, such as one that is 3 inches thick rather than 2 inches.

  • Best pressure relief mattress topper for back sleepers

If you're a back sleeper, you probably need more support. So, it's always better to go for a latex mattress topper with medium or medium-firm support. These mattress toppers can help you meet your needs for the perfect back support. They also provide great cushioning in your vulnerable areas, like the tailbone and heels.

  • Best pressure relief mattress topper for stomach sleepers

Like back sleepers, stomach sleepers also need more support. This means that a medium or medium-firm latex mattress topper is often the best choice for you! They offer the firm support you need while also providing a great deal of comfort for your knees and ribs. Make sure you don't go for memory foam or any other topper that may make you "sink." This is because these toppers can make breathing and moving in bed more challenging.

FAQs

1. Can a mattress topper help with pressure points?

Absolutely! A mattress topper can really make a difference with pressure points. High-quality options like latex or high-density memory foam with gel infusions are great options as they provide much-needed support. Thereby, they evenly distribute body weight, which can alleviate discomfort in areas such as the hips, shoulders, and lower back.

2. What is the number one best mattress topper?

The best mattress topper can vary depending on individual preferences and needs. However, latex mattress toppers are often highly regarded for their ability to provide excellent comfort, pressure relief, breathability, and responsiveness. Memory foam mattress toppers are another top choice. They conform to the body's shape, provide pressure point relief, and also offer motion isolation.

3. Is memory foam good for pressure relief?

Memory foam is an excellent option for providing pressure relief. It molds to the shape of your body, responding to heat and pressure, which helps distribute weight evenly. This characteristic allows memory foam to alleviate pressure points by providing support where it's needed most, such as the hips, shoulders, and back. Memory foam mattress toppers are popular for this reason among those seeking enhanced comfort and reduced pain.

However, keep in mind that memory foam comes with its own set of drawbacks. Studies prove that cheap memory foam material tends to retain heat and off-gas toxic chemicals. So, before you buy a topper made of memory foam, make sure it is certified and tested for toxins.

4. What is the best mattress topper for bad shoulders?

The best mattress topper for bad shoulders generally includes materials that provide adequate cushioning and support. Memory foam and latex mattress toppers are often recommended for their ability to conform to the body's contours and relieve pressure on sensitive areas like the shoulders. Look for a topper with medium to medium-firm support, as this can provide the right balance of comfort and support to help alleviate shoulder pain and promote better sleep quality.

5. Does a mattress pad help with pressure point relief?

Mattress pads primarily serve to improve the overall feel of a mattress and protect it from wear and tear. They provide a slight cushioning layer that can make a mattress softer or smoother to lie on, thereby enhancing initial comfort levels.

However, in terms of addressing pressure points—those areas where the body experiences heightened stress and discomfort—mattress pads have limited effectiveness. Pressure points typically occur at joints like the shoulders, hips, and knees, where the body's weight is concentrated. For effective relief, materials are needed that can conform closely to the body's contours and distribute weight evenly across the surface of the mattress.
